Horn
Just recently bought my MK1 golf, and there is a third party stearing wheel on it. When i press the horn it makes a very quite kind of 'tut' noise and the lights dim in the car! i need a horn lol! is this an earth issue, where is my horn?
Any help greatfully recieved.

Use a secondary relay near the battery and make up a mimi loom to run the horns. Or replace the appropriate loom wires.

Horns are located under the front valence on the passengers side of your car. They are right at the front and real easy to get at. Just run a new supply from your new realy to this and you will be laughing…
